Rancho Palos Verdes,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rancho Palos Verdes?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rancho Palos Verdes Studio Apartments | $2,182 | $1,325 | $4,995 |
| Rancho Palos Verdes 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,693 | $1,600 | $6,900 |
| Rancho Palos Verdes 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,624 | $1,890 | $10,000+ |
Rancho Palos Verdes 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,831 | $3,150 | $10,000+ |
| Rancho Palos Verdes 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,230 | $3,600 | $5,529 |

Rancho Palos Verdes 3 Bedroom Apartment Units with Current Availability by Neighborhood
Availability Confirmed As of: July 29, 2026There are currently 29 available 3 Bedroom apartment units from neighborhoods all over Rancho Palos Verdes, CA that range in price from $3,200 to $17,610. Miraleste, Silver Spur and Coastal Zone are the neighborhoods that currently have the most 3 Bedroom availability. Here is today's list of the top neighborhoods in Rancho Palos Verdes with the most available 3 Bedroom apartments:
| Neighborhood | Available Units | Median Price | Min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Miraleste | 23 | $5,029 | $4,288 |
| Silver Spur | 3 | $4,393 | $3,200 |
| Coastal Zone | 1 | $4,750 | $4,586 |
| East Rancho Palos Verdes | 1 | $4,288 | $4,288 |
| Monaco | 1 | $4,750 | $4,586 |
